Join Terran McGinnis, Marineland’s historian, as we time-travel from 1938 in St. Augustine, FL at Marine Studios – an underwater film studio – to complete closure during WWII; from the #1 tourist attraction in Florida and the leading source of marine science discovery to bankruptcy and decline; from rebirth as a state-of-the art dolphin interactive facility to the present day as Marineland Dolphin Adventure. Learn about the firsts in the world of architecture, film-making, and research, as well as animal care, breeding, and training. Whatever your interests, this presentation will have something for you!
